Ambarvale high School is located in Rosemeadow and is part of the Camden network of schools. We currently have 829 students, which includes 53 students in our Support Unit. 30% of students come from a non-English speaking background and 15.5% ident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ander.
We have approximately 69 teaching staff in our established staff, with additional staff purchased by the school to ensure the effective implementation of a range of educational programs and initiatives. Our staff includes an Executive Leadership Team made up of 15 leaders (11 Head Teachers, 3 Deputy Principals, 1 Principal).
We also have approximately 25 non-teaching staff and a number of paraprofessionals including a speech therapist, a community liaison officer and a wellbeing and health in-reach nurse.
